Output e33b81d3bc4ace96d1ae1201707c8e1a05741a14cc1f6025f0dd28e25cbb1db2:1

value
27471601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2aa5617caabe2f4bedaa708eb5e06bbedf80c25 OP_EQUAL
address
3Ltut14GQkjVLThGyFQdvp974g2MS6ETxQ
transaction
e33b81d3bc4ace96d1ae1201707c8e1a05741a14cc1f6025f0dd28e25cbb1db2
spent
true